Is Turquoise More of a Green or Blue Colour? May 1st 2007 07:36
Traditionally used to describe an ancient colour gem stone meant to symbolise good fortune. While at the same seals one protection when worn and ensure the well-being of its wearer. Interestingly enough the gem-stone itself is scientifically claimed to be copper aluminium phosphate the colour is a result of a combined blue coming from the copper and green from the iron. However it said that the colour Turquoise is always has combined greenish or blueish tone. This is the very isue being raised whether Turquoise is really more or green or blue shade. Is this why it defined as in-between colour for its greenish quality yet blue trait. As on the colour spetrum scale the blue and green are right next to eachother whereby the Turquoise is located.
